Exercise 1-18: Reading with Staircase 1 Intonation 2 CD 1

Track 27

Read the following with clear intonation where marked.

Hello, my name is__________________. I'm taking American Accent Training. There's

a lot to learn, but I hope to make it as enjoyable as possible. I should pick up on the American

intonation pattern pretty easily, although the only way to get it is to practice all of the time. I

use the up and down, or peaks and valleys, intonation more than I used to. I've been paying

attention to pitch, too. It's like walking down a staircase. I've been talking to a lot of

Americans lately, and they tell me that I'm easier to understand. Anyway, I could go on and on,

but the important thing is to listen well and sound good. Well, what do you think? Do I?
